Count on one court per four participants. For 16 people you need 4 courts, for 24 people 6 courts.
Americano is by far the most popular format. Everyone plays all day, partners rotate every round and it works across all levels mixed together.
An Americano with 16 participants on 4 courts takes around 3 to 4 hours, including the warm-up and the prize ceremony.
The biggest cost is court hire: €20 to €35 per hour per indoor court. For a group of 20 people, count on €800 to €1,300 total including drinks.
Yes. Americano is made for mixed-level groups. Every round, beginners are paired with more experienced players.
